# Shell script conventions

Conventions for writing production-quality bash scripts in this repository. These complement the universal style rules (imperative-mood comments, verb-led function names, primary logic first, long-form CLI options).

## Script anatomy

Bash does not support forward function references — a function must be defined before it is called during execution. To keep primary logic visually prominent while ensuring all functions are defined before use, wrap the main flow in a `main()` function and call `main "$@"` at the bottom.

### Key structural rules

- **Shebang**: `#!/usr/bin/env bash` (not `/bin/bash`).
- **Strict mode**: `set -euo pipefail` unless there is a documented reason to omit a flag (e.g., `((count++))` returns 1 when count is 0 under `set -e`).
- **Header docblock**: Purpose, behavior notes, usage synopsis. Written as comments at the top of the file, before any code.
- **`readonly PROG`**: Use `$PROG` in all user-facing messages for consistency.
- **`main()` wrapper**: Wrap the main flow in a `main()` function. Call `main "$@"` at the bottom of the file, after all function definitions.
- **Main flow first**: Option parsing, validation, dependencies, core logic — inside `main()`.
- **Helpers at end**: Place helper functions after `main()`, before the `main "$@"` call.

## Help and exit codes

| Situation | Exit code |
| ---------------------------------------- | ---------------------- |
| `--help` or `-h` (explicit help request) | 0 |
| Bad input, missing arguments | 1 |
| Unknown command / subcommand | 2 |
| Required external command not found | 127 (POSIX convention) |

`show_usage` accepts an optional exit code parameter, defaulting to 1:

```bash
show_usage() {
cat >&2 <<USAGE
...
USAGE
exit "${1:-1}"
}
```

Call sites: `show_usage 0` for help requests, `show_usage` (bare) for errors.

### `--help` must be handled manually

`getopts` only handles single-character options. It sees `--help` as `--` (end of options) followed by positional argument `help`. Always add a manual check before the `getopts` loop (inside `main()`):

```bash
if [[ "${1:-}" == "--help" ]]; then
show_usage 0
fi
```

## Argument parsing

**Short-option scripts** (few flags): Use `getopts` with a preceding `--help` check.

**Long-option scripts** (multiple long flags): Use a `while-case-shift` loop. This handles both `--flag value` and `--flag=value` forms:

```bash
while [[ $# -gt 0 ]]; do
case "$1" in
--size=*) SPLIT_SIZE="${1#*=}" ;;
--size) SPLIT_SIZE="$2"; shift ;;
--dry-run) DRY_RUN=true ;;
-h | --help) show_usage 0 ;;
-*) echo "$PROG: Unknown option $1" >&2; show_usage ;;
*) POSITIONAL="$1" ;;
esac
shift
done
```

**Subcommand scripts**: Parse the subcommand first, then flags:

```bash
if [[ $# -lt 1 ]]; then
show_usage
fi
cmd="$1"; shift
# ... parse flags ...
case "$cmd" in
list) do_list ;;
prune) do_prune ;;
*) echo "$PROG: Unknown command '$cmd'" >&2; show_usage ;;
esac
```

## Error messages

- **Always to stderr**: `echo "..." >&2`
- **Prefix with `$PROG:`**, so that piped output identifies the source.
- **Be actionable**: Tell the user what to do, not just what went wrong.

```bash
# Bad
echo "Error: Not found"

# Good
echo "$PROG: Stable worktree not found at $path" >&2
echo "Create it with: git worktree add $path main" >&2
```

## Dependency checks

Preflight-check external commands before using them:

```bash
for cmd in wt jq; do
if ! command -v "$cmd" &>/dev/null; then
echo "$PROG: Required command '$cmd' not found" >&2
exit 127
fi
done
```

Use `command -v` (POSIX), not `which` (non-standard behavior across platforms).

## Common mistakes

| Mistake | Fix |
| -------------------------------------- | ------------------------------------------------------------------------------------------------------------ |
| `set -e` alone | Use `set -euo pipefail` — `-u` catches typos in variable names, `pipefail` catches mid-pipeline failures |
| `usage()` as function name | Use `show_usage()` — functions start with verbs |
| `show_usage` always exits 1 | Accept exit code parameter: `exit "${1:-1}"` |
| `which cmd` to check availability | Use `command -v cmd` (POSIX-portable) |
| Error messages to stdout | Always `>&2` |
| Interpolating user input into `jq` | Use `jq --arg name "$value"` for safe binding |
| `${var//pat/repl}` with dynamic `repl` | Add `shopt -u patsub_replacement 2>/dev/null \|\| true`; bash 5.2+ expands `&` in `repl` to the matched text |
| Hard-coded values that vary | Accept as arguments or use `readonly` defaults at the top |
| Duplicating logic across scripts | Extract to `functions/` and source it |
